COMSATS and ANSO contributing to South-South cooperation

Islamabad March 7, 2021 Islamabad: As the process of developing the 2030 Agenda for Sustainable Development started, the world was increasingly conscious of the need to develop new and innovative cooperation modalities. This brought a new impetus to the developing countries in the South to increase the depth and breadth of their cooperation to address common socio economic and development challenges, such as Global health, climate change, food security, good governance etc. Over the past three decades, the importance of South-South and triangular cooperation has been particularly highlighted by the Commission on Science and Technology for Sustainable Development in the South (COMSATS). As stated in the Foundation document establishing the Commission in 1994, its basic purpose is to “provide leadership and support for major South-South and North-South cooperative schemes in education, training and research” to its member states.
